Guidelines for evaluating information

• Author• Subject and tendency• Purpose and target group• Currency• Edition• Publisher• References

How do I determine if an article is scholarly (”scientific”) or not?• Who has written the article?• Where is the article published?• Has the article been peer-reviewed?

Elements of a peer reviewed original article

• Introduction• Methods and material• Results

And• Discussion

What is Zotero?

• Zotero is a freely available reference management system which helps you to sort and arrange your references.

It will help you to:• import references from various databases into one place• keep track of your references• spell correctly• create references and a reference list in your Word document• adapt the layout of the references in accordance with different

reference systems
